How Hospitals Use Cardiac Registry Data to Improve Patient Outcomes
Hospitals need the ability to identify risks earlier, recognize patterns in care delivery, and make informed decisions that improve both patient outcomes and operational performance. Cardiac registry data plays a critical role in that process. When used strategically, cardiac registry data helps healthcare organizations uncover trends, evaluate outcomes, identify gaps in care, and strengthen quality improvement initiatives across cardiovascular programs.
This has become increasingly important as cardiovascular disease remains the leading cause of death worldwide. According to the World Health Organization, cardiovascular disease accounts for approximately 17.9 million deaths each year. Cardiac Registry Data Supports Better Clinical and Operational Decisions
Cardiac registry data has become an essential operational and clinical resource that helps healthcare leaders make more proactive, data-informed decisions. Cardiac registry data gives healthcare organizations a broader view of how care is delivered across patient populations over time. Instead of relying solely on individual patient cases, hospitals can use cardiac registry data to identify larger trends that affect patient outcomes, operational efficiency, reimbursement, and long-term cardiovascular program performance.
For example, data from the ACC NCDR CathPCI Registry helps hospitals monitor treatment timelines, complication rates, bleeding events, mortality rates, and 30-day readmissions following cardiac procedures. These benchmarks allow organizations to compare their performance against national standards and identify areas where care delivery may need improvement.
Cardiac registry data also helps hospitals identify patients at higher risk for complications or readmission. One national study using NCDR CathPCI Registry data found that nearly one in seven PCI patients were readmitted within 30 days of discharge. Researchers used registry data to identify risk factors associated with readmission, helping hospitals strengthen discharge planning, improve follow-up care, and better allocate resources for higher-risk patients.
Hospitals also use cardiac registry data to evaluate broader operational and quality trends, including:
- Readmission patterns following cardiac procedures
- Delays in treatment timelines such as door-to-balloon times
- Mortality and complication rates
- Variations in outcomes between patient populations
- Medication compliance after discharge
- Length-of-stay trends
- Opportunities for earlier intervention and follow-up care
These insights help healthcare organizations move beyond reactive care models and make more informed clinical and operational decisions.
The financial impact is significant as well. According to the Centers for Disease Control and Prevention, heart disease costs the United States approximately $168 billion annually in healthcare services, medications, and lost productivity. Reducing avoidable complications, improving care coordination, and identifying risks earlier can improve both patient outcomes and operational efficiency.
When cardiac registry data is accurate, complete, and consistently maintained, it becomes a powerful tool for improving both clinical outcomes and cardiovascular program performance.
Turning Cardiac Registry Data Into Action
Collecting cardiac registry data alone does not improve outcomes. Hospitals must also ensure the data is accurate, actionable, and consistently maintained so healthcare teams can confidently use it to guide patient care, quality initiatives, and operational decisions.
As cardiovascular programs grow and reporting requirements continue evolving, maintaining high-quality cardiac registry data becomes increasingly challenging. Many hospitals face growing abstraction workloads, staffing shortages, and limited internal resources to support ongoing registry management and quality oversight.
